Overview of GBridge for Windows
GBridge is a free Windows utility that makes sharing files and accessing remote machines straightforward. It creates a virtual private network-style connection so people can connect securely over the internet. With a simple, approachable interface, it reduces the technical overhead of accessing shared resources and collaborating, making it a practical option for single users and small groups.
Core Functionality
- Peer-to-peer connections to speed up direct transfers between machines
- Encrypted file transfers to protect data in transit
- Remote desktop control for accessing and managing other PCs remotely
- File synchronization to keep folders up to date across devices
As a no-cost tool, GBridge covers the basic needs for improving productivity and smoothing collaborative workflows without additional software expenses.
Best Use Cases
GBridge suits users who need secure, ad-hoc connections between a few computers—freelancers, small teams, or home users who want an easy way to share files and remotely manage systems without complex setup.
